Ephesians 6:10 “Finally, my brethren, be strong in the Lord and in the power of His might.”
As Paul’s letter to Ephesians begins to come to a conclusion, he is going to finish strong by teaching how a believer can be strong in the ongoing spiritual warfare they face daily. Paul knows believers have an enemy that the Apostle Peter described as a roaring lion who is seeking whom he may devour. Thus, to conclude, Paul lays out the equipment to do battle with our enemy as well as equipping the believer on how to use the equipment as they encounter our vicious enemy.
Going into this pivotal teaching on the section normally called the Armor of God he starts with an exhortation that provides the resources needed for implementing the exhortation. More than a pep talk or cliché about being strong, Paul INSTRUCTS the believer (brethren) to be STRONG by utilizing the strength and the power that comes from the Lord.
To handle spiritual warfare, we must have the Savior’s strength.
This idea of reliance on the Lord’s strength is not a knew concept. For instance (and I will only give a few as there are many verses):
Philippians 4:13 I can do all things through Christ who strengthens me.
Ephesians 3:14 For this reason I bow my knees to the Father of our Lord Jesus Christ,16 that He would grant you, according to the riches of His glory, to be strengthened with might through His Spirit in the inner man,
Colossians 1:9 For this reason we do not cease to pray for you, and to ask that you may be…11 strengthened with all might, according to His glorious power, for all patience and longsuffering with joy;
Nehemiah prayed that God would strengthen his hands. Nehemiah 6:9
We have a resource to handle life – to handle the spiritual battles of life! “The whole secret of spiritual strength resides in union with the Lord.” (Cambridge Bible for Schools and Colleges) As He is in us and we are in Him and we abide in Him, we have the strength and the power to handle any temptation that the world, the flesh, or the devil presents to us.
We can be confident when having encounters with our enemy because of who is in us, and He who is in us is stronger than he that is in this world. (1 John 4:4)
